How to use agentic general tools
We have normalized the pieces an agent usually needs in any sector: documents, communication, charges, deliveries and connections. Each tool can be used with the application’s implementation, with a third party’s or with one of your own, depending on the functionality and the availability of the system you choose.
The tools the application uses must meet a compatibility schema (API schema) to be connected; if they do not meet it, they are not used. Credentials can be yours or a third party’s: when a third party provides them, their use is also subject to that third party’s terms and conditions.
You can use open-source tools, develop your own from your organization’s programming team, or commission the development to connect your systems with the application. Nothing is tied to a vendor: the same schema works for anyone who meets it.
How the tools work
The agent requests a tool, the tool validates that the schema is compatible and executes it against the external or internal system you decide. The database can live in your infrastructure or in an external service, and the tool only reads or writes what the permission allows. Every call goes into the account usage log, with time, origin and system; if something fails, it returns the error and does not invent a confirmation.

GEN-T14 API Connect
Lets the agent execute tasks outside the platform against your APIs: create an order, update a system, move a machine. The connection uses API key or OAuth 2.1 depending on the service, and every sensitive operation asks for approval before going out, so control stays with your team or your server.
Features: declared operations · approval per operation · API key or OAuth 2.1 · logging and retries.
GEN-T15 Webhook connectors
Receives events from your systems by webhook: validates the signature, queues the event and retries if something fails. The credential the system demands can be API key or OAuth 2.1, as the case requires. This is the inbound path; the outbound one is API Connect.
Features: registration · signature and credential · retries · logbook.
